Possible Leaked Information On Zelda Wii

Months ago, Nintendo revealed that they are working on a new Zelda game for the Wii. All that we had to go on was a concept image of a swordless Link and an unknown female character. Many people have made speculations about who this new character is, from the Great Fairy Queen to her being some sort of incarnation of the Master Sword.

What we do know for certain to be truth:

  • The game will diverge from the established dungeon-field-dungeon gameplay style.
  • This Link will be older than any of the previous Links.

Rumors have recently been circulating around the internet about some new leaked information about the upcoming title. These rumors apparently originated from 2chan.net, a popular Japanese site much like 4chan. The site has been known for leaking real information about popular games in the past. Right now, this information has yet to be verified as truth.

Take a look and decide for yourself.

  • The girl on the Zelda Wii picture is not the Master Sword, and as of now there are no plans for Link to get the Master Sword in the game. Her name is Aderu, and she’s not your typical companion like Navi or Midna, in that she’s rarely there with you.
  • Your sword will come with different unlockable abilities.
  • Aderu uses to communicate with you through your sword.
  • You can select whether you’re right or left-handed, and Link will be the same.
  • The basic mechanics and gameplay elements are finished, and they’re currently building the story, dungeons and developing characters. Among them are an innkeeper in the town where Link lives and her son, who idolizes Link.
  • Horseback combat is back, with a more intelligent Epona that is better at avoiding obstacles.
  • The character models for Link, Epona, and the Gorons have all been modified and touched up, but they’re the only ones.
  • The game will not only take place in Hyrule (maybe not even Hyrule at all).
  • This Link is the same Link from Ocarina of Time and Majora’s Mask.
  • The game involves time travel.

As much as I’d love it to be true, I think this is fake.  I just have a hard time believing that this game will feature The Hero of Time. So please, take this information with a grain of salt until Nintendo verifies it to be the truth.
